CHAP. 587.— An Act Limiting the creation or extension of forest reserves in New Mexico and Arizona.June 15, 1926. [[S. 565](/us/bill/69/s/565).] [[Public, No. 392](/us/pl/69/392).] *Be it enacted by the Senate and House of Representatives of the United States of America, in Congress assembled*,National forests.Creation or additions in New Mexico, Arizona of, forbidden except by Act of Congress. That hereafter no forest reservation shall be created, nor shall any additions be made to one heretofore created, within the limits of the States of New-Mexico and Arizona except by Act of Congress. Approved, June 15, 1926.
